West Ham United play host to Crystal Palace in the Premier League tonight.

Sky Sports pundit Paul Merson predicted the outcome of tonight’s Premier League clash between the Hammers and the Eagles at the London Stadium, when writing his regular prediction column for Sky Sports.
West Ham head into the game on the back of a woeful performance against Wigan in the FA Cup – one that culminated in their elimination from the competition.
Palace, meanwhile, last played 10 days ago, and were absolutely hammered by Arsenal at the Emirates, although they have been on a decent run on the whole.

The Hammers sit just one point and two places above the Eagles in the table, so tonight’s game is hugely important for both sides, for obvious reasons.
Merson wrote his regular prediction column for Sky Sports, and predicted somewhat of a surprising outcome at the London Stadium tonight:

“It was a very poor result for West Ham at the weekend. I really don’t get it when Premier League teams go out to lower league opposition in the cup. I know the Premier League sides make changes but it really shouldn’t happen. This is a big football match for both teams. I’m going to forget about Crystal Palace’s performance at Arsenal. They started so poorly and were blown away in the first 20 minutes but I’m expecting a better showing from them here. I picked them for victory at the Emirates so I have to keep faith with them here.”
Prediction: West Ham 1-2 Crystal Palace
David Moyes’ side can climb as high as ninth with a win tonight, whilst Roy Hodgson’s men can also jump up to ninth spot with all three points.
With both sides in such desperate need of a victory, there should be a lively game of football on display at the London Stadium tonight.
